What’s in the box and how it’s laid out
The kit is straightforward: white felt wheels and heads in four shapes—1-inch discs, 1/2-inch discs, conical points, and cylindrical points—plus 1/8-inch shank mandrels. The 1/8-inch shank is the standard for most Dremel-style rotary tools and every piece I tried seated cleanly in both a Dremel and a generic single-speed rotary tool.
The assortment is the real draw. The 1-inch wheels handle broad, flat surfaces like faucet escutcheons and knife bolsters, while the 1/2-inch wheels get into tighter curves. The conical and cylindrical heads earn their keep around inside corners, screw recesses, and around lugs on watch cases—places where discs either can’t reach or risk catching an edge.

Setup and compatibility
Everything here is plug-and-play. The felt discs mount on the included mandrels via a simple screw-top. The cones and cylinders are permanently mounted to their shafts. I didn’t run into fitment issues with either keyed or collet-style chucks. If your tool accepts 1/8-inch shanks, you’re covered.
One caveat: with the thinner felt discs, the screw tip on the mandrel can protrude slightly above the felt face. That’s a risk when working on softer finishes—you don’t want a steel point making first contact. I solved this in a few ways depending on the job:
- Stack two 1/2-inch wheels for extra thickness.
- Add a tiny fiber washer under the screw.
- Favor the cone/cylinder heads (which have no protruding screw) where possible.
It’s a small detail, but worth addressing up front to avoid accidental scratches.
Performance and polish quality
Felt is all about density and balance. Cheap felt can fluff apart or glaze instantly; good felt holds compound and stays true. The XUPYNAR wheels land on the better side of that line. They held together at low-to-medium speeds with moderate pressure, and they took polishing compound evenly without shedding or unthreading themselves.
On chrome fixtures, I ran at roughly 10,000–15,000 RPM with a light touch and a pea-sized amount of compound. The wheels stayed put on the mandrels and didn’t mushroom prematurely. One 1-inch wheel was enough to bring back the shine on a tub spout and matching trim, with only mild rounding at the edges after several minutes of continuous use.
For jewelry and watch cases, I dropped the speed and used the smaller wheels and cones with very light pressure. The felt’s consistency let me feather edges without creating dips, and the cones slipped under bracelet links where discs would chatter. I kept separate wheels for different compounds (e.g., one for cutting compound, one for rouge) to avoid cross-contamination; the felt loads and holds compound well, so switching compounds without swapping wheels is a bad idea.
Glass edges and small tool surfaces benefitted from the cylindrical points. They’re dense enough to keep their shape, which is key for maintaining a straight line when polishing a chamfer.
Durability and wear
These are consumables, but I paid attention to how quickly they break down. Across multiple sessions:
- The discs stayed centered and didn’t fly apart, even when I got impatient and bumped the speed up.
- The cones and cylinders wore predictably, rounding off at the tip rather than shredding.
- The mandrel screws didn’t back out once tightened; a small dab of compound on the screw threads adds a bit of friction if you’ve had issues with other brands working loose.
Expect the discs to glaze over with compound after a while. A quick touch with a felt rake, a nylon brush, or even a scrap of rough fabric cleans the surface and restores bite. If a wheel starts to pick up too much heat and smear compound, you’re either pushing too hard or spinning too fast—back off and let the felt do the work.
Control, heat, and finish
Control with felt is all about speed and pressure. I found the sweet spot at:
- 5,000–10,000 RPM for delicate work (jewelry, watch cases, plated hardware).
- 10,000–15,000 RPM for tougher surfaces (unplated stainless, brass, chrome).
Keep the wheel moving and avoid digging in; felt will cut faster than you think with the right compound. If you’re chasing scratches, pre-sand or use an abrasive rubber point first. Polishing wheels are finishers, not miracle workers.
I didn’t notice significant heat buildup unless I parked the wheel in one spot. The bigger 1-inch discs dissipate heat better; the smaller shapes will heat up in tight spaces—watch that on delicate finishes.
What it’s good for—and what it isn’t
Strengths:
- Restoring shine on hardware, instruments, tools, and small automotive trim.
- Polishing knife bolsters and guards after sanding to 600–1200 grit.
- Cleaning up watch cases and jewelry where control matters.
- Touching the edge of glass or acrylic without chipping.
Limitations:
- Not a substitute for sanding; it won’t erase deep scratches or pitting on its own.
- Felt sheds a bit at high RPM on sharp edges—mask sensitive areas.
- The mandrel screw protrusion on thin discs needs a minute of setup to mitigate.
Tips to get the best results
- Dedicate specific wheels to specific compounds. Label a few in marker on the shank if you switch often.
- Let the compound come to temperature; a short, light pass to “charge” the wheel, then a second pass does cleaner work than a heavy first pass.
- Keep a soft brush handy to de-load the felt.
- Stack discs for thicker, flatter faces, and use cones for tight radii to avoid catching the edge of a disc.
- Protect adjacent surfaces with painter’s tape, especially around plated fixtures.

Antique Jewelry Revival
Use the small conical and cylindrical felt heads to clean, de-tarnish and polish rings, brooches and chains. Start with a mild polishing compound on the larger wheels for flat areas, then switch to conical tips to reach bezels, prongs and tight links. Finish with a soft 1" wheel for a mirror shine. Great for turning thrift-store finds into wearable pieces.
Stamped Metal Pendant Line
Hand-stamp brass or copper blanks, then use the half-inch and conical wheels to deburr, smooth edges and bring raised letters up to a bright contrast. Combine a light patina in recesses with selective polishing on lettering for a professional two-tone look. Small batches are perfect for craft fairs and Etsy.
Glass & Mirror Edge Polishing
After cutting or etching glass pieces (coasters, ornaments, pendants), clean and smooth sharp edges with the small cylindrical and conical felt heads. The kit’s varied sizes reach inner curves and delicate bevels, producing a safe, satin or glossy edge without heavy grinding—ideal for handmade glass gifts.
Scale Models & Miniature Metalwork
Use the tiny wheels to polish brass photo-etch parts, metal wheels, and chrome details on scale models. Remove casting flash, brighten brass components and create realistic wear effects by selectively polishing raised surfaces. The interchangeable shapes let you work on everything from locomotive boilers to watch-sized gears.
